Title: Biosynthesis and secretion of follicle-stimulating hormone beta-subunit from ovine pituitary cultures: effect of 17 beta-estradiol treatment

An assay was developed to detect tritium-labeled ovine FSH beta-subunit (( /sup 3/H)oFSH beta) secreted from primary ovine pituitary cultures. This procedure used affinity-enriched antibodies raised against reduced and carbamylmethylated oFSH beta (RCM-oFSH beta) in a two-cycle immunoextraction procedure. A discrete species with an apparent mol wt of 21,000 was detected in sodium dodecyl sulfate electrophoretic patterns of immunoextracts from culture medium. This species was identified as RCM-(/sup 3/H)oFSH beta by its comigration with highly purified RCM-oFSH beta, its reduction in culture media after cultures were treated with 17 beta-estradiol, which normally decreases radioimmunoassayable oFSH; and its displacement from the extracting antibodies by excess unlabeled RCM-oFSH beta. The assay was used in a pulse-chase study to determine that (/sup 3/H)oFSH beta is secreted within 1-2 h of its synthesis. Prior treatment of cultures with 17 beta-estradiol did not change this timing of secretion.
